Why Trending Topics Matter on Xiaohongshu
Xiaohongshu occupies a unique position in the digital marketing landscape. It is simultaneously a social network, a search engine, and a shopping platform — a combination that makes trending content extraordinarily powerful. When a topic trends on XHS, it does not simply get more impressions. It gets surfaced to users who are actively searching for recommendations, making purchase decisions, and sharing discoveries with communities they trust. The commercial intent baked into the platform means that trending exposure translates to tangible business outcomes far more directly than on entertainment-first platforms.
For brands, this creates an asymmetric opportunity. A well-timed piece of content aligned with a rising trend can earn organic reach that would otherwise cost a significant paid media budget to replicate. More importantly, because XHS users are known for their high trust in peer recommendations and their tendency to save and share content they find genuinely useful, trend-aligned posts have a longer shelf life than typical social media content. A note (XHS’s term for a post) that taps into a trending topic authentically can continue driving discovery and saves for weeks after the initial wave.
How the Xiaohongshu Algorithm Amplifies Trends
Understanding the XHS algorithm is the foundation of any effective trend strategy. Unlike platforms that primarily rely on follower graphs, Xiaohongshu’s recommendation system is heavily interest-based. Content is distributed to users based on topic relevance, engagement signals, and keyword matching — which means even accounts with modest followings can achieve significant reach if their content aligns with what the algorithm is currently amplifying.
The algorithm tracks several key signals when deciding whether to push a piece of content further. Early engagement velocity matters enormously: posts that collect saves, likes, and comments quickly in their first few hours are flagged as high-quality and get pushed to broader audiences. Keyword usage within captions and titles also directly affects discoverability, particularly because many XHS users search for content the same way they would search on Google. When a topic is trending, the algorithm actively boosts content tagged with related keywords, creating a compounding effect where early movers earn disproportionate visibility.
This is why timing is everything. Brands that identify a trending topic early and publish quality content before the wave peaks capture the algorithm’s amplification window. Those who join too late find themselves in an overcrowded conversation where standing out becomes considerably harder.
Where to Find Xiaohongshu Trending Topics
Spotting trends before they peak requires monitoring multiple signals simultaneously. Fortunately, Xiaohongshu provides several native tools that brands can use alongside third-party intelligence sources.
Native Platform Features
- XHS Search Bar Autocomplete: Typing partial keywords into the search bar reveals what users are actively searching for. Rising search terms often signal emerging trends before they appear in curated trend lists.
- Discover and Hot Topics Page: The platform’s built-in trending section highlights hashtags and topic clusters gaining momentum in real time. Checking this daily gives brands a reliable pulse on what is resonating.
- Category Leaderboards: Within specific interest verticals — beauty, food, travel, fashion, fitness — XHS surfaces the top-performing content of the moment, revealing which sub-topics and aesthetics are driving engagement.
Third-Party Intelligence and Community Listening
Beyond native features, brands serious about trend intelligence should invest in social listening tools that monitor XHS keyword volume, sentiment, and post frequency over time. Platforms specialising in Chinese social media analytics can surface early signals that are not yet visible on the trending pages. Additionally, following influential KOLs (Key Opinion Leaders) and KOCs (Key Opinion Consumers) in your category is one of the fastest ways to catch emerging trends, since these creators are often the originators or early adopters of viral content moments. How to Ride Viral Waves: A Step-by-Step Approach
Reacting to trends effectively is a skill that combines speed, editorial judgment, and creative execution. Here is a practical framework for turning a trending topic into a brand opportunity.
- Qualify the trend first. Not every trending topic is right for every brand. Before creating content, assess whether the trend aligns with your brand values, your audience’s interests, and your product category. Forcing a connection that does not exist will feel inauthentic to XHS users, who have a well-developed radar for brand-speak.
- Identify your unique angle. The worst trend content simply mimics what everyone else is doing. The best trend content takes the trending topic and presents it through a lens that is distinctly yours — whether that means a category-specific application, a contrarian take, a behind-the-scenes perspective, or an unexpected pairing with your product.
- Optimise for XHS search intent. Once you have your angle, build your content around the keywords users are actually searching. Include the trending hashtag in your title and caption, but also weave in related long-tail keywords that describe the specific value your post delivers. This ensures your content continues to be discoverable after the initial trend wave subsides.
- Publish during peak activity windows. XHS engagement tends to spike during lunch hours (12:00–13:00) and evening hours (20:00–22:00) in China Standard Time. Publishing within these windows maximises the early engagement velocity that triggers algorithmic amplification.
- Engage immediately after posting. Respond to early comments, encourage saves, and interact with users who engage. This signals to the algorithm that the content is generating genuine community interest, which directly influences how broadly it is distributed.
Content Formats That Perform Best During Trend Cycles
Not all content formats are equally effective when riding a trend. On Xiaohongshu, certain formats consistently outperform others during viral moments because they align with how users consume and share trending content.
Image carousels remain one of the highest-performing formats on XHS. Multi-slide posts allow brands to tell a complete story — introducing the trend, connecting it to their product or perspective, and delivering a clear takeaway — in a format users habitually swipe through. Carousels also tend to earn more saves, which is a particularly valuable signal on XHS because saved content is revisited and often shared in private messages.
Short videos have grown significantly in importance as XHS continues to invest in its video infrastructure. During trend cycles, video content that demonstrates a product in the context of the trend — a tutorial, a transformation, a real-life application — can generate enormous engagement because it combines entertainment value with the practical information XHS users seek.
Authentic review-style notes are the format most native to the platform’s DNA. A personal, first-person account of how a product connects to a trending experience or lifestyle moment feels genuinely earned in a way that polished brand advertising does not. During trend cycles, this format benefits from the trust economy that makes XHS uniquely powerful.
How Brands Successfully Tap into XHS Trends
Some of the most effective trend activations on Xiaohongshu share a common characteristic: they feel like a natural part of the conversation rather than a brand inserting itself. When the “city walk” trend swept XHS — a movement celebrating slow, exploratory urban strolling — footwear and outdoor lifestyle brands that had already positioned themselves around comfort and everyday movement were perfectly placed to participate. Their content did not need to be retrofitted; it was a natural extension of what they already stood for.
Similarly, seasonal trends tied to Chinese cultural moments — such as the intense skincare conversations that accompany winter or the travel content explosion during Golden Week — reward brands that have built up a consistent content presence and can activate quickly with trend-adjacent content. The brands that succeed are those that treat trend participation as a component of a broader content marketing strategy rather than a one-off tactical play. Common Mistakes Brands Make with Trending Content
Even brands with genuine XHS presence frequently make avoidable errors when chasing trends. Understanding these pitfalls is just as important as knowing what to do right.
- Joining the trend too late: Publishing trend content after a topic has already peaked means competing in a saturated conversation with minimal algorithmic support. The window for meaningful organic amplification is typically short — often 48 to 72 hours from the moment a topic starts gaining serious traction.
- Prioritising volume over quality: Rushing to post something — anything — to capitalise on a trend often produces content that is visually weak, poorly written, or strategically vague. XHS users are discerning, and low-quality content can damage brand perception even when it is topically relevant.
- Ignoring community guidelines: XHS has specific content policies, particularly around advertising disclosure and product claims. Brands that publish trend content without appropriate disclosures risk post removal or account penalties that can undermine the entire strategy.
- Neglecting influencer partnerships: Many of the most powerful trend activations on XHS are driven not by brand accounts but by KOLs and KOCs who create authentic content that their audiences trust. Brands that try to ride trends purely through owned channels miss the amplification multiplier that influencer marketing provides on this platform.
Staying Ahead: Building a Trend-Ready Content Strategy
The brands that consistently benefit from Xiaohongshu trends are not the ones that react the fastest to individual moments. They are the ones that have built the infrastructure — creative assets, content processes, influencer relationships, and analytical capabilities — that allows them to respond quickly and well when the right moment arrives. This is the difference between a reactive trend strategy and a proactive one.
A trend-ready content strategy starts with a clear understanding of your core content pillars and how they intersect with the interest categories most active on XHS in your sector. From there, building a library of adaptable content formats — visual templates, approved messaging frameworks, pre-approved product imagery — gives your team the raw materials to move quickly without sacrificing quality. Regular trend monitoring, ideally supported by data tools and a network of category influencers, keeps your team informed about what is rising before it peaks.
Finally, integrating your XHS trend strategy with your broader digital marketing ecosystem ensures that viral moments on the platform translate into measurable business outcomes.
